The concept of Lab Scale line for carbon fiber is based on flexibility, speed and scalability to change and modify equipment parameters for the needs of customers in Carbon Fiber research for experimentation with traditional or emerging precursors, process tweaking and development of samples for up to 1 tons per year. With state of the art fiber handling system it can accommodate line speeds ranging from 0.1 m/min to over 1 m/min and tows from 10 filaments to 48000 filaments, enabling the study of effects of various process parameters using a small amount of precursor. The heat treatment system is the ideal size for research and development as well as quality control, with continuous processing of up to 3 tows. It is highly customizable and can be configured as a complete system including Oxidation Ovens, LT and HT furnaces up to 1600°C, material handling equipment, and all pre and post treatment process stages found on commercial scale plants. The systems allow for maximum manipulation of key process parameters, including controlling tension after each unit operation and multiple zones of temperature control in oxidation, pre-carbonization and carbonization. The drive systems are designed for precision control of the forces imparted to the fiber, allowing for flexibility in tow counting, loading, and drive position. This flexibility yields greater customization of oxidation for Carbon Fiber research activities, with adjustability zone by zone, pass by pass, and carbonization. Overall plant footprint for an example line as shown here is approximately 40m L x 10m W x 4m H. Start-up for the equipment from ambient conditions takes 8 to 12 hours. Shut down can occur in a shorter time frame. To optimize the life of the equipment and minimize thermal cycling, we recommend that the LT and HT furnaces be at idled at temperature for short downtime durations (i.e. over a weekend) for cleaning the deposits in cooler section of furnaces. This also optimizes power, when considering the requirements for heat-up.

AntsProsys RTA furnace is a compact rapid thermal processing tube furnace with a processing quartz tube and vacuum flanges. It is designed for annealing semiconductor wafers or solar cells with diameters from 2” to up to 6". The furnace is heated by 8-16 units of 1KW halogen light with a max. the heating rate of 50 oC/second. A 30 segment precision temperature controller with +/-1 oC accuracy is built into the furnace to allow for heating, dwelling, and cooling at various steps. RS485 port and control software can be included to make monitoring the temperature profile via PC while simultaneously running furnace possible. This furnace can also be modified into an RTE, CSS or HPCVD furnace.

AntsProsys dental furnace is equipped with 4 robust high-quality heating elements made of MoSi2. The furnaces are made with vacuum formed insulation of best grade to ensure they can be heated and cooled very fast to provide for fast turnaround times. With uniform heat distribution these furnaces provide best results and minimum maintenance issues in long run. The dental crowns and frameworks are placed in sintering trays which are filled with a bed of zirconium support beads. The trays are designed to fit exactly in the furnace chamber. The bed of zirconia beads allows for a sintering process with low friction and results in distortion-free frameworks. The dental furnace is equipped with a programmer with four individually configurable programs with 4 ramp/dwell segments. The maximum temperature of 1550 °C allows the majority of commercially available zirconium oxides to be processed. Any interruption to the sintering process, for example by a power failure, is displayed by the programmer. This ensures that the sintering process of the dental furnace is completed correctly and the crowns and frameworks have the desired density and stability. The dental furnace is supplied complete with sintering tray and support beads.

Thermal treatment of materials in protective gas or vacuum is a commonly used process in material science. Besides its function to prevent oxidation, gas and mixtures of gases can be used to modify material surface, e.g. nitrating or carbonising. In general, two different designs of furnaces for thermal treatment can be distinguished: A “cold-wall” design and a “hot-wall” design. In “cold-wall” furnaces the heater and the insulation are installed inside a vacuum or gas tight chamber. In a “hotwall” system a vacuum and/or gastight retort, so-called muffle, is heated from the outside. The design of the antsProsys furnace line is based on the “hot-wall” principle. The heating system consists of spirals of Kanthal A1© wire or APM© wire. These wires are placed in notches of the inner insulation, which is usually made of ceramic light bricks. Micro porous material on the backside complete the insulation. This whole unit is encaged in a metal frame. A gap between the frame and the outside housing, filled with air, leads to an additional insulation effect. This design limits the maximum surface temperature of the furnace to 50°C above room temperature. In the standard configuration the furnace is heated from three sides and also from the bottom. Additional heaters can be installed on ceramic tubes at the roof of the furnace. A furnace with this improved heating power allows an operation at elevated temperatures up to 1200°C or a faster heating cycle with heavy loads.

The Bridgman method uses a pre-synthesized material that moves slowly through a temperature gradient. The melted material moves through a decreasing temperature gradient and forms a single crystal. antsProsys offers multi-zone vertical tube furnaces which are mounted on a pulling device engineered specifically for the Bridgman method. The short heated multiple hot zone length creates an accurate and ideal gradient for the Bridgman method. The temperature decreases towards the bottom of the furnace. The pulling motor lowers the sample with an adjustable speed toward the lower temperature. As an option, close to the sample is a thermocouple can be placed for accurate reading of the sample temperature. Both, sample and probe thermocouple are attached to the sample lowering device. The movement of the sample can be fast for loading and unloading or with a user defined speed for crystal growth.
